CHEVROLET SILVERADO 2010 2.G User Guide Driver Information Center (DIC)
The DIC display is located at the bottom of the
instrument panel cluster. It shows the status of many
vehicle systems and enables access to the
personalization menu.

CHEVROLET SILVERADO 2010 2.G User Guide Vehicles with dual stage airbags also have a drivers
seat position sensor which enables the sensing system
to monitor the position of the driver seat (all models).
